Output e63a3a5c656d2f8f142b5f65dd95eee16c05767fe49c28dd67ebe1979c2ab7c9:0

value
371768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 260f59f4d03b434a9ca7d8586aa0fcde2c76c8fd OP_EQUAL
address
35AFzU2Gj7goasdtkUg7i6KYamjQCTyuBk
transaction
e63a3a5c656d2f8f142b5f65dd95eee16c05767fe49c28dd67ebe1979c2ab7c9
confirmations
203895
spent
true